Tasman Environmental Markets (TEM) is an Australian carbon offset provider operating at tasmanenvironmental.com.au. The company partners with businesses to support decarbonisation goals by connecting them with high-quality climate action projects. TEM offers a carbon credit marketplace, offsetting solutions, and API-driven technology under the BlueHalo® brand, enabling businesses to integrate emissions calculations and carbon offsetting into their digital platforms. It serves clients across Australia and the broader APAC region.

Tasman Environmental Markets (TEM) offers three main categories of products and services. First, a carbon offset and carbon credit marketplace where businesses can browse and purchase credits linked to climate action projects. Second, marketplace solutions designed to help businesses structure and manage their carbon offsetting activities. Third, the BlueHalo® API, a proprietary technology platform that allows businesses to integrate emissions calculations and carbon offsetting functionality directly into their own digital products and customer experiences.

Tasman Environmental Markets (TEM) serves businesses of all sizes seeking to achieve sustainability and decarbonisation goals. Its stated target audience includes leading global brands, corporates, travel organisations, airlines, and transport businesses. These organisations typically use TEM's marketplace to purchase carbon credits or to integrate carbon offsetting into their operations and customer-facing digital platforms via the BlueHalo® API. TEM's client base is primarily located in Australia and the broader APAC region.
